Estancia Los Potreros
A beautiful reserve in the Sierra Chicas near to Cordoba, Los Potreros estancia dates from 1574 and today is an organic working cattle farm breeding Aberdeen Angus cattle and Peruvian Pasano horses.Owned by the same Anglo-Argentine family for four generations, accommodation on the farm is simple yet comfortable, and all rooms have private facilities. Hosteria Rincón del Socorro
Rincon del Socorro originated from a main ranch building dating back to 1886. Since it has been restored and expanded yet retains the classic Spanish style consisting of great galleries, ideal to escape the heat of the sun and a cosy main living room with fireplace for cooler days.
